6/15: Girls Rock Camp Showcase at Zanzabar


The annual Girls Rock Louisville Summer Camp Showcase will be at Zanzabar on Friday, June 15th from 5:30-7:00 p.m.With performances from nine new bands formed at by the campers at Girls Rock Louisville 2018 Camp.
This is an all-ages, family-friendly event. Doors open at 5:30 p.m. and GRL bands will perform at 6:00 p.m.  $5

 Girls Rock Louisville empowers girls and gender non-conforming youth from all backgrounds by exploring music creation in a supportive, inclusive environment.

1/14 Girls Rock Louisville Album Release at Guestroom



The 2nd Annual Girls Rock Louisville album will be released  on Sunday,  JAN. 14TH, with an album release party at 11 AM- 2 PM at Guestroom Records (1806 Frankfort Ave). The cost to attend is free and the 9 track CD will be available for $8. The songs are the end result of the Girls Rock Louisville music camp. At the end of the camp the girls' bands recorded their songs at La La land recording studio. To learn more about Girls Rock Louisville, please visit: www.girlsrocklouisville.org

6/16: Girls Rock Camp Showcase at Headliners

The Girls Rock Camp for girls and gender-nonconforming youth will be held next week, and will host a showcase at Headliners on June 16th, after their week-long program.

5/4: Thurby with Girls Rock Louisville

On May 4th at  OUTERspace (732 E. Market St.) The Girls Rock Louisville mentoring program and music camp will be throwing  a fundraiser in support of Girls Rock Louisville’s 2017 Summer Camp Financial Aid fund and will feature the bands Half-Seas-Over, On The Bang, Grlwood, and Lung (with Daisy Caplan of Foxy Shazam).
 The $10 cover will go towards Girls Rocks’ financial aid fund, which provides financial assistance for campers in need to attend the program at a free or reduced cost.
